Broken Spring

This is our most frequent Country Club emergency. Torsion springs here rust from the inside out due to delta humidity cycles, then snap without warning — often during a heatwave when the metal is already thermally stressed. Spring repair runs $180–$340. We replace with galvanized springs rated for corrosive environments, not the standard oil-tempered sets that fail prematurely in this microclimate. Never attempt to release tension from a broken torsion spring yourself; the stored energy can cause serious injury.

Snapped Cable

Cable failures cluster in Country Club’s narrow single-car garages where limited headroom creates sharper angles and more wear at the drum end. Corrosion accelerates the fraying. Cable repair costs $130–$250. We inspect the drum, bearing plate, and spring balance as part of every cable replacement, because a cable snap often signals broader system fatigue.

Door Won’t Open

When a Country Club garage door refuses to open, the cause is usually spring failure, opener malfunction, or track obstruction. We diagnose systematically: manual release test, spring balance check, opener force settings, then track alignment. Our technicians are trained on Chamberlain, Genie, and LiftMaster openers — the three brands we see most often in this neighborhood’s mid-century homes.

Door Won’t Close

Doors that reverse or stall during closing are a security and safety issue, especially when tule fog rolls in and homeowners need to secure vehicles quickly. We check force limits, safety sensor alignment, and track clearance. In Country Club’s older garages, we often find that shifted foundations or sagging headers have thrown off the door geometry, requiring adjustment beyond simple opener tuning.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Country Club Homes

  • Rust-accelerated torsion spring failure from delta humidity. Homeowners are consistently surprised to find severe corrosion on springs only six years old. The evening delta breeze pulls moisture into garages that feel dry during the day, creating condensation cycles that standard springs can’t survive.
  • Broken cables at the drum end in narrow single-car garages. Limited headroom creates steeper cable angles and concentrated wear. Combined with corrosion, this means cable failures happen earlier and more suddenly here than in newer construction with generous clearances.
  • Tracks warped by thermal expansion in 100°F+ heat. Older steel rails, especially in tilt-up conversions, expand and buckle during summer afternoons. The door jumps track, often bending panels or damaging rollers in the process.
  • Opener strain from poorly balanced doors. Decades of spring fatigue in original hardware forces openers to work harder, burning out motors and stripping gears. We see this constantly in Country Club’s unmodified 1960s installations.

Pricing for Emergency Garage Door in Country Club, CA

Here’s what typical emergency repairs cost in the Country Club market. These ranges reflect our actual invoices across San Joaquin County; your specific quote depends on door size, hardware condition, and whether structural modification is needed for narrow openings.

Service Price Range
Spring Repair $180–$340
Cable Repair $130–$250
Track Realignment $120–$240
Opener Repair $120–$320
General Garage Door Repair $150–$600

Factors that push costs higher in Country Club: header reinforcement for modern standard-width doors in narrow postwar openings, rust-damaged hardware requiring full system replacement, and converted garages with non-standard clearances.
